Oh vey… the narrator!
Reviewed: 11-10-23
Story was good, not great. Lost interest in the “kids” and kept forgetting names and relationships. If I had read it (rather than listen to it) I would have given it a higher rating. But - the narrator. Bad on so many levels. Normal speaking voice is grating, very unappealing, and too young. Male voices were substandard. Then, when attempting emotion, I felt like my ears were going to bleed from the harshness. Detracted so much from the story. I only felt relief when I was done.

Memory was fonder than the new listening experience
Reviewed: 07-06-23
I recall having enjoyed this back when originally published. I didn’t engage with this version. The narrator’s voice was ok, but sounded much older than the female lead. The book felt “choppy” and lacked the character development that would have made some of them more likable - maybe it translated better in writing or I’ve just grown more “picky” (spoiled by Nora Roberts.)
